From 0aededef214653e8f68aab51d6b9958dafd2b8d4 Mon Sep 17 00:00:00 2001 From: Felix Neubauer Date: Thu, 23 Apr 2026 10:53:24 +0200 Subject: [PATCH] release 2.5.0 --- CHANGELOG.md | 7 +++++++ CONTRIBUTING.md | 7 ++++--- codemeta.json | 2 +- meta_configurator/package-lock.json | 4 ++-- meta_configurator/package.json | 2 +- 5 files changed, 15 insertions(+), 7 deletions(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index ec126eaf..592879ea 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-8,6 +8,13 @@ and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0 --- +## [2.5.0] - 2026-04-22 + +### Added + +- Add next/previous buttons to the search bar for easier navigation through search results +- Add copy/paste support for schema diagrams + ## [2.4.0] - 2026-04-15 ### Added diff --git a/CONTRIBUTING.md b/CONTRIBUTING.md index 6d5215b1..df293cbf 100644 --- a/CONTRIBUTING.md +++ b/CONTRIBUTING.md @@ -98,9 +98,10 @@ No specific format is enforced, but commit messages should start with a verb and ## Releases Releases are managed manually by maintainers. When a set of changes on `develop` is deemed stable, a maintainer will: -1. Update the version in `meta_configurator/package.json` -2. Add a changelog entry -3. Merge `develop` into `main` +1. Update the version in `meta_configurator/package.json` and `codemeta.json`. +2. Run `npm install` to update the lock file version. +3. Add a changelog entry to `CHANGELOG.md` following the format defined in that file +4. Merge `develop` into `main` --- diff --git a/codemeta.json b/codemeta.json index 8705142d..16565733 100644 --- a/codemeta.json +++ b/codemeta.json @@ -105,7 +105,7 @@ "Browser", "Web" ], - "version": "2.0.0", + "version": "2.5.0", "contIntegration": "https://github.com/MetaConfigurator/meta-configurator/actions", "codemeta:continuousIntegration": { "id": "https://github.com/MetaConfigurator/meta-configurator/actions" diff --git a/meta_configurator/package-lock.json b/meta_configurator/package-lock.json index 3e8c9a64..8a709e79 100644 --- a/meta_configurator/package-lock.json +++ b/meta_configurator/package-lock.json @@ -1,12 +1,12 @@ { "name": "meta-configurator", - "version": "2.4.0", + "version": "2.5.0", "lockfileVersion": 3, "requires": true, "packages": { "": { "name": "meta-configurator", - "version": "2.4.0", + "version": "2.5.0", "dependencies": { "@apidevtools/json-schema-ref-parser": "^15.3.1", "@comake/rmlmapper-js": "^0.5.2", diff --git a/meta_configurator/package.json b/meta_configurator/package.json index 35c6d7a3..53492c80 100644 --- a/meta_configurator/package.json +++ b/meta_configurator/package.json @@ -1,6 +1,6 @@ { "name": "meta-configurator", - "version": "2.4.0", + "version": "2.5.0", "private": true, "scripts": { "dev": "vite",